Pacifica receives permits to drill new Claudia targets

PSIL · Price

Executive Summary

  • Pacifica Silver Corp. has received permits to drill up to 153 additional sites at its Claudia project in Mexico, enabling exploration of high-priority targets identified by 2022 surface sampling.
  • The company is reallocating drill rigs to test the Mina Vieja and Mina de Oro areas (previously untested) and conduct follow-up drilling at the Justina vein, while one rig continues definition drilling at Aguilarena.
  • Recent surface rock chip samples returned significant high-grade gold and silver intercepts, including up to 23.6 g/t Au and 77 g/t Ag at Justina, and up to 22.7 g/t Au and 480 g/t Ag at Mina Vieja/Mina de Oro.

Key Details

  • Permit Authorization: New permits authorize exploration drilling at up to 153 additional drill sites on the 100%-owned Claudia silver-gold project in Durango, Mexico.
  • Mina Vieja and Mina de Oro Targets:
    • Located in the southern portion of the project.
    • Previously untested.
    • Surface rock chip samples returned up to 22.7 g/t Au and 480 g/t Ag.
    • Results extend the Aguilarena-Tres Reyes vein system potential by at least 500 meters south of the historical Tres Reyes mine.
  • Justina Vein Area:
    • Surface rock chip samples returned up to 23.6 g/t Au and 77 g/t Ag.
    • Drill Hole 25CLAU059D intersected 2.10 m grading 3.53 g/t Au and 460 g/t Ag from 219.00 m downhole.
    • Included higher-grade interval: 0.80 m grading 9.01 g/t Au and 1,175 g/t Ag from 219.00 m.
    • Confirms high-grade mineralization at depth.
  • Phase II Drill Program Status:
    • Three diamond drill rigs are active.
    • Two rigs will be reallocated to test Mina Vieja/Mina de Oro and follow up at Justina.
    • One rig remains dedicated to definition/expansion drilling at the Aguilarena vein system.
  • Additional Sampling:
    • 172 additional surface rock chip samples collected from the southern portion of the project for assaying to refine geological models.
  • QA/QC Details:
    • Drill samples analyzed by ALS Minerals (ALS) in North Vancouver, Canada (Fire assay with AA finish for Au; ICP-AES for Ag and other elements).
    • Surface samples analyzed by SGS de Mexico (Fire assay with AAS/Gravimetric finish for Au; ICP-AES for Ag).
    • Qualified Person: Patrick Loury, AIPG CPG.

Notable Quotes

  • "We are very pleased to receive this new set of permits within six weeks of application... These approvals allow us to immediately follow up on our recent high-grade discovery at the Justina vein and to drill test the highly prospective Mina Vieja and Mina de Oro areas in the southern portion of the project for the first time." — Todd Anthony, CEO
